在 sql server 2000 中的語法是
String driverName = "com.microsoft.jdbc.sqlserver.SQLServerDriver";
String dbURL = "jdbc:microsoft:sqlserver://ip:1433;DatabaseName=sample","user","pawd";
而 sql server 2005 則為
String driverName = "com.microsoft.sqlserver.jdbc.SQLServerDriver";
String dbURL = "jdbc:sqlserver://ip:1433;DatabaseName=sample","user","pawd";
這樣子就大功告成,如果是要方便往後的系統沿用,可以包成公用物件.jar,程式需要連到sql資料庫時下 connection會比較簡便。
package test;
import java.sql.*;
public class connDB {
private static String driver = "com.microsoft.sqlserver.jdbc.SQLServerDriver";
private static String sourceURL = "jdbc:sqlserver://ip:1433;DatabaseName=name";
private static String user = "test";
private static String password = "(密碼)";
private static Connection conn = null;
public connDB() {
try{
Class.forName(driver);
conn = DriverManager.getConnection(sourceURL,user,password);
}
catch(Exception ex)
{
System.out.println(ex.getMessage());
}
}
public static Connection getConn()
{
return conn;
}
}
沒有留言:
張貼留言